Everyday Kitchen Counters Made Beautiful

Whether your style leans warm and rustic or sleek and modern, there’s beauty to be found in the everyday.

A few thoughtful details; like artful groupings of canisters, cutting boards, or a simple vase of blooms; can turn even a busy kitchen into a space that feels calm and curated.

These ideas prove that your counters can be as inspiring as they are functional.
